CVE-2026-72852: Integer Overflow or Wraparound in hank-ai darknetCVE-2026-72852 0 CVE-2026-72852 is an integer overflow vulnerability in hank-ai darknet's convolutional layer buffer size calculations. The vulnerability arises from unchecked 32-bit integer arithmetic when sizing heap buffers based on .cfg file parameters, causing buffer allocations to wrap to small or zero values. This leads to undersized allocations and subsequent out-of-bounds reads and writes during convolutional layer operations. Exploitation requires loading a crafted .cfg file for inference or training, without needing a valid weights file. The vulnerability can cause heap buffer overflow and allocator metadata corruption.
